Description
SPAX® Hex Washer Head construction fasteners with HCR® coating are intended for wood-to-wood connections in exterior structural applications when attaching treated lumber components. These fasteners are designed with a hex head conventional driver system along with a built in washer for applications requiring additional surface area under the head for superior pull-down force. Ideal for deck ledger attachment. Often used for blind, high torque applications where additional engagement of socket to screw head is needed.
Material & Coating
Cold-rolled “carbon steel” wire heat treated to Grade 5 durability and plated with an HCR® (High Corrosion Resistance) double barrier coating. “HCR” is tested and recognized for use in ground contact pressure treated lumber for exterior, freshwater general construction applications (e.g. AWPA UC1-UC4A, UCFA).

SPAX PowerLags®
SPAX PowerLags offer the largest selection of code-recognized structural wood-to-wood fasteners in the industry. Featuring SPAX patented thread technology, they require no pre-drilling, and drive faster and easier than conventional lags and other structural lag screws. Available in hex head with HCR coating options for use in interior and exterior applications, including treated lumber.
• No pre-drilling required (1/4" and 5/16")
Note: Lead holes of 11/64" (0.172") diameter is required for 3/8" and 13/64" (0.203") diameter is required for 1/2" POWERLAGS
• Grade 5 durability
• IRC / IBC Code Compliant DrJ TER No. 1912-07 Structural Fastener Properties
• Independently tested and approved DrJ Technical Evaluation Reports (TER No. 1711-01; Deck Ledger Attachment)
• Patented thread serrations require up to 40% less driving torque to increase installation speed while helping prevent cracking in logs
• Built-on washer head designs eliminate the need and extra cost of a separate washer
• Fastener length stamp on the head provides convenient identification without measuring and aids on-site inspections
